“Firewalls, IDS/IPS and UTM” talk at Radware workshop
Radware is an application delivery, security, availability and performance optimization solutions vendor. They build several interesting security appliances such as DefensePro box which provides intrusion prevention in a very innovative way based on fuzzy logic technology. The Supercomputing Center of Catalonia (CESCA), as a regional research and academic network manager, organizes several technical workshops for its constituency such as universities and research centers.
Radware and CESCA are jointly organizing in Barcelona a workshop titled “Improving Intrusion Prevention Systems (IPS) through Fuzzy Logic” that will provide a security review about IPS and specially about how DefensePro approaches it. Carmen Navarro and Ivan Puig from Radware will be running most of the workshop. Francesc Rovirosa from Universidad Oberta de Catalunya (UOC) will describe their successful deployment of that product. I will be giving the introductory talk called “Mom … what does a FW, IDS/IPS, UTM do?” that will try to give a brief overview about protection systems and their differences so that the IPS approach could be fully understood.
